How to Give Digital Art as a Gift

1. Print and frame your digital art like a traditional photo

One of the easiest methods to present your digital art piece as a gift is to simply print it and frame it, like you would any other photo.

This may be done at home, though you’ll need a few supplies to accomplish the task:

  • A photo capable printer
  • Photo paper
  • Your chosen frame
  • Matting (optional, if desired)

If you don’t have or want to get the tools to complete this at home, there are a variety of online printing services that will do it for you! Just send them your file, specify the size you want, and they’ll print and ship it to your door.

In both instances, I recommend making sure that your number of pixels is appropriate for the size photo you’d like. If you’re enlarging a very small piece of art to fit an 8×10 frame, it’s going to look blurry and undesirable.

Once you’ve got your digital art printed as a physical photo, just pop it in the frame. Wrap it up, and you’re ready to gift!

6. Give digital art in a digital picture frame

Gift your digital art in a digital picture frame, and preserve the original way in which it was created. This thoughtful gift also allows the recipient to display other photos or additional artwork in the future.

Like any of the print styles, you’ll still need to make sure your art is appropriately sized for the frame so it doesn’t become distorted or grainy once on display.

Most frames utilize an SD card that you’ll load with art or photo files from your computer. Then, place it into the designated slot on the digital frame, and they’re ready to show off!

Wrap the entire frame as a gift! Alternatively, if the recipient already has a digital frame, just include the updated SD card in a greeting card. It’s a wonderful gift option either way.

7. Create a USB file from your digital art for display on a TV

Modern televisions are shipping with USB connections nowadays. Of course, it’s used for hooking up a variety of cables and peripherals, but it’s a great way to display digital art as well. Gift someone your digital art on a USB, and they can display it on their TV.

Simply plug a USB into your computer and copy the art files that you want over. Then, gift the USB stick to your recipient. It’s that simple! I’m a big fan of this 64GB pentode radio tube flash drive we reviewed because of how awesome it looks!

They’ll plug it into the back of their TV, and be able to enjoy your art on the “big screen”. Some TVs even have an ambient mode that displays images when in standby. Your work of art could be adoring the wall when programming isn’t actively being watched. I love it!

8. Convert your digital art to a wallpaper size for smartphone or desktop

In the same vein as displaying on a TV, why not convert your digital art to a smaller size? It’s likely that your gift recipient has a smartphone, tablet, laptop, or desktop computer. By giving your digital art to them in a suitable size, they’ll see it every day.

Since there’s a large variety in phones and tablets in terms of screen size, you’ll want to scale your design appropriately.

An aspect ratio of 16:9 is standard for phone wallpaper (Source) so try to keep your artwork within these confines if this method of gifting is your intent.

The nice thing about gifting digital art this way is that it’s a digital file. I would just email it to my recipient along with a nice message. That’s much cheaper than forking out shipping costs if your giftee lives far away!
